Cultural Tides Conference 2025

The must attend conference for culture in Hull.

This year will see the launch of Hull’s new Culture and Heritage Strategy 2025-30.

Speakers will include Darren Henley (Chief Executive: Arts Council England), Eilish McGuinness (Chief executive: National Lottery Heritage Fund) and Sandra Wall (UNESCO Creative Cities Network Norrskoping). Hull-based arts, cultural, voluntary, community, education and business sector organisations with interest in the cultural ambition of the city are invited to join us to hear from nationally and internationally significant speakers and panelists. The event will include the opportunity to participate in relevant workshops with a focus on moving the Culture & Heritage Strategy and delivery plan forward.

The event will form part of the Colliderfest festival; a collaboration between Hull City Council, the Hull Maritime project, Hull Museums and Gallery, and the University of Hull exploring the dynamic connections between science, technology, engineering, art, and maths.

A pioneering theatre with a unique Northern Voice, locally rooted, global in outlook, inspiring artists, audiences and communities to reach their greatest potential. We produce and present inspiring theatre that reflects the diversity of a modern Britain. We provide the resources, space and support to grow people and ideas, are an ambassador for our city, a flagship for our region and a welcoming home for our communities. Through our work with schools and local communities we engage with thousands of young people, disabled groups and adults, offering opportunities to participate in the arts, whether as the first step into a career, a way to build confidence and meet new people, or as part of a rounded education.
